Custom Door Installation: A Comprehensive Guide
Custom door installation is a substantial home enhancement task that can boost aesthetics, increase energy effectiveness, and improve security. From front entry doors to interior restroom doors, the ideal options can transform the feel and look of a home. This short article explores the different elements of custom door installation, consisting of the benefits, products, procedures, and regularly asked concerns.
Why Choose Custom Doors?
The decision to install custom doors brings numerous advantages to property owners. Here are some key advantages:
Personalization: Custom doors can be tailored to match particular designs, colors, sizes, and surfaces that line up with a house owner's vision.Quality: Custom doors are often crafted from premium materials, resulting in increased resilience and durability compared to mass-produced alternatives.Energy Efficiency: A well-insulated custom door can assist control indoor temperatures, leading to lower energy expenses.Boosted Security: Custom doors can be designed with security functions that are not just functional but likewise visually pleasing.Boost Home Value: Installing custom doors can enhance curb appeal and increase the general value of a home.Kinds Of Custom Doors

Comprehending the installation procedure can assist homeowners feel more positive in their custom door job. Below are the basic actions included:
1. Consultation and DesignTalk about preferences, styles, and spending plan with a professional installer.Acquire measurements for the door opening.2. Choice of MaterialsChoose the door material, design, and extras such as hardware and finishes.3. FabricationThe picked design is custom-made based upon the requirements discussed.Lead time varies, typically varying from a few weeks to a couple of months.4. Preparation for InstallationGet rid of the old door (if relevant) and prepare the door frame.Guarantee that the frame is level and square.5. InstallationThe brand-new door is carefully installed, guaranteeing all components fit correctly.Appropriate sealing and weather-stripping are used to improve energy efficiency.6. Last TouchesChange hinges and locks for optimum performance.Apply surfaces or paint if needed.7. AftercareGo over upkeep tips with the installer to ensure longevity.Arrange any necessary follow-up services.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How long does it normally take to install a custom door?
A1: The installation time can vary based on the intricacy of the job however generally ranges from a few hours to a full day. Ordering time for custom doors might take a number of weeks depending on the production.
Q2: Are custom doors more expensive than pre-made alternatives?
A2: Yes, custom doors typically cost more due to the tailored style and materials. Nevertheless, the investment can lead to increased residential or commercial property value and energy savings over time.
Q3: Can I install a custom door myself?
A3: While some useful property owners may attempt to set up a custom door themselves, it is suggested to employ a professional installer to ensure proper fitting and performance.
Q4: What should I do if my custom door does not fit correctly?
A4: In the event that your custom door does not fit, consult your installer instantly. They can evaluate the problem and recommend solutions, which might include modifications or refinishing.
Q5: How do I maintain my custom doors?
A5: Regular upkeep differs by material but normally includes cleansing, lubricating hardware, inspecting seals and weather-stripping, and refinishing wood doors.
